#@@# Pitch Accuracy#@#
Consistent pitch across links ensures smooth engagement with sprockets, minimizing chain whip and vibration under load. Accurate spacing reduces accelerated wear on both chain and sprocket teeth, extending replacement intervals and preserving equipment uptime.
#@@# Hardened Link Construction#@#
Heat-treated links resist deformation and surface fatigue during high-torque cycles in mixers, conveyors, and drive trains. Durable metallurgy lowers the frequency of part swaps and reduces inventory consumption for replacement components, enhancing operational efficiency.
#@@# Standard Compatibility#@#
Designed to mesh with common No. 80 sprocket profiles, the assembly supports direct replacement without machining or reconfiguration. Technicians can perform field swaps using existing mounting hardware, significantly shortening repair windows and minimizing downtime.

• Delivery times may vary based on location.#@@#deliverynotes#@#NA#@@#Maintenance Guide#@#Inspect the NO. 80 DRIVE CHAIN ASSEMBLY (BLA14126) for wear, elongation, and damaged rollers; replace the chain if elongation exceeds tolerance to prevent failure. Clean the assembly with a noncorrosive solvent, remove debris, and dry thoroughly before lubrication. Lubricate pins and rollers with food-grade lubricant based on operating hours; log service dates and lubricant type. Verify sprocket alignment and tension; adjust sag and torque to reduce fatigue.
